Awesome World Class Metal band. If I were to write a collectors book on heavy metal. I would have this band rated in the top tier of the world class bands of all time.

The Second Coming was the best album. I liked the increase in the POWER and INTENSITY factor, in comparison to the debut.

But with "Battle's At Helms Deep" I really played that album non-stop since it was release. Even to this day. I still play this album, non-stop, just like Mercyful Fate's "Melissa" and Satan's "Court in the Act"

Since the album "Battle At Helms Deep" has a different vocalist Bob Mitchell, and a different guitar team, the songwriting direction was really different from "The Second Coming". This album is really unique for its time of release. There was alot of creative songwriting and riffing, on "Battle At Helms Deep". I always will appreciate the wide range of dynamics and atmosphere, that is part of "Battle at Helms Deep's" appeal.

I actually loved 'The Second Coming' when I was just discovering Attacker, but I believe the first one has a bit more of an 'adventurous feel' to it and when I listen to both records today 'Battle At Helm's Deep' is easily my favourite Attacker record - and it gets my vote.

As many of you probably have, I've also seen them at KIT X in 2008. Really great show and it was also to be Bob Mitchell's last with them. Haven't heard any news on the recent Attacker activities, but Bob has since reformed Sleepy Hollow and they'll be releasing a new album soon.
